Open guide →GuideDeactivate without deleting briefs
Deactivation removes runtime hooks, menus and assets while preserving collected data.
Open guide →GuideUnderstand the keep-data uninstall option
The installed keep-data option defaults to 1; setting it to 0 allows most module tables to be dropped during uninstall.
Open guide →GuideUnderstand signature-table uninstall behaviour
The supplied uninstall script drops the signature table regardless of the general keep-data option; export required evidence before uninstall.
Open guide →GuideUnderstand the seven module tables
Requests, answers, uploads, activity, email logs, signatures and form templates store the live workflow.
Open guide →GuideUnderstand installed options
Admin notification email, email from-name, reminder days (default 2) and keep-data-on-uninstall are installed.
